Scottish Championship roundup: Rangers gain ground on Hearts

Sports Mole rounds up Saturday's Scottish Championship action as Rangers close the gap at the top with a win at Dumbarton and Falkirk thrash Cowdenbeath 6-0.

Rangers reduced Hearts' lead at the top of the Scottish Championship to six points with a comfortable 3-0 win away to Dumbarton this afternoon.

Kenny Miller, Lee Wallace and Kris Boyd found the net to put some pressure on the Jambos, who take on Hibernian in the Edinburgh derby tomorrow.

The result of the afternoon was Falkirk's emphatic 6-0 victory over bottom club Cowdenbeath in which six different players were on target - Rory Loy, David Smith, Alex Cooper, Peter Grant, David McCracken and Will Vaulks.

A 1-1 draw at home to Alloa Athletic was enough to move Raith Rovers up to fourth in the table, and shift the visitors off the bottom in the process.

Queen of the South remain in third, despite surrendering a two-goal lead away to Livingston, who salvaged a point thanks to late goals from Daniel Mullen and Gary Glen.

Results in full: Dumbarton 0-3 Rangers, Falkirk 6-0 Cowdenbeath, Livingston 2-2 Queen of the South, Raith Rovers 1-1 Alloa
